使用GoogleDriveAPI(Javaclient)对应用程序进行单元测试的最佳方法是什么??似乎编写的应用程序严重依赖Drive类,但缺少...创建一个非常广泛的模拟(它本身可能需要进行测试),或者编写依赖于实际云端硬盘服务的集成测试...如何测试这样的应用程序?使用类似Mockito的模拟框架使用DriveAPI(Java客户端)有点乏味,因为DriveJava客户端的使用依赖于进行如此多的链式调用(例如,来自文档):Driveservice=getDriveService(req,resp);service.files().get(fileId).execute();
文章目录前言1.群晖SynologyDrive套件的安装1.1安装SynologyDrive套件1.2设置SynologyDrive套件1.3局域网内电脑测试和使用2.使用cpolar远程访问内网SynologyDrive2.1Cpolar云端设置2.2Cpolar本地设置2.3测试和使用3.结语前言群晖作为专业的数据存储中心,在我们的工作生活中越来越常见,无论是家庭存储照片、影视剧,还是办公场所存储商业资料,群晖系统都能发挥数据中心的作用,方便我们随时存储和调用各类数据文件。当然,群晖的作用不仅限于此,我们还可以利用群晖的Drive套件与cpolar配合,让用户能在其他网络(非办公室局域网)
文章目录前言1.群晖SynologyDrive套件的安装1.1安装SynologyDrive套件1.2设置SynologyDrive套件1.3局域网内电脑测试和使用2.使用cpolar远程访问内网SynologyDrive2.1Cpolar云端设置2.2Cpolar本地设置2.3测试和使用3.结语前言群晖作为专业的数据存储中心,在我们的工作生活中越来越常见,无论是家庭存储照片、影视剧,还是办公场所存储商业资料,群晖系统都能发挥数据中心的作用,方便我们随时存储和调用各类数据文件。当然,群晖的作用不仅限于此,我们还可以利用群晖的Drive套件与cpolar配合,让用户能在其他网络(非办公室局域网)
我创建了一些填充谷歌电子表格的工具。它工作正常1年,从今天开始我出错了Exceptioninthread"main"com.google.gdata.util.AuthenticationException:Errorauthenticating(checkservicename)atcom.google.gdata.client.GoogleAuthTokenFactory.getAuthException(GoogleAuthTokenFactory.java:688)atcom.google.gdata.client.GoogleAuthTokenFactory.getAuthT
文章目录前言1.群晖SynologyDrive套件的安装1.1安装SynologyDrive套件1.2设置SynologyDrive套件1.3局域网内电脑测试和使用2.使用cpolar远程访问内网SynologyDrive2.1Cpolar云端设置2.2Cpolar本地设置2.3测试和使用3.结语前言群晖作为专业的数据存储中心,在我们的工作生活中越来越常见,无论是家庭存储照片、影视剧,还是办公场所存储商业资料,群晖系统都能发挥数据中心的作用,方便我们随时存储和调用各类数据文件。当然,群晖的作用不仅限于此,我们还可以利用群晖的Drive套件与cpolar配合,让用户能在其他网络(非办公室局域网)
我正在使用os.rename()尝试在驱动器之间移动pdf文件。尝试这个我收到错误:OSError:[WinError17]Thesystemcannotmovethefiletoadifferentdiskdrive有人知道包含与os.rename类似功能并允许跨磁盘文件传输的函数吗? 最佳答案 os.rename()更改文件的路径但不移动磁盘上的实际数据。这就是为什么您不能将它从一个驱动器移动(重命名)到另一个驱动器的原因。在驱动器之间移动其实就是先复制它,然后再删除源文件。当您尝试在两个驱动器之间传输文件时,您可以使用shut
我正在构建一个使用Google驱动器API的python应用程序,所以开发进展顺利,但我在检索整个Google驱动器文件树时遇到问题,我需要这样做有两个目的:检查路径是否存在,所以如果我想在root/folder1/folder2下上传test.txt,我想检查文件是否已经存在,如果存在则更新它构建一个可视文件浏览器,现在我知道谷歌提供了他自己的(我现在记不起名字了,但我知道它存在)但我想将文件浏览器限制为特定文件夹。现在我有一个获取Gdrive根目录的函数,我可以通过递归调用一个列出单个文件夹内容的函数来构建这三个函数,但它非常慢并且可能会向谷歌发出数千个请求这是NotAccepta
我想要的程序的流程是:将xlsx电子表格上传到驱动器(它是使用pandasto_excel创建的)将其转换为Google表格格式指定任何知道链接的人都可以编辑它获取链接并将其分享给将输入信息的人下载完成的表格我目前正在使用PyDrive,它解决了步骤1和5,但还有一些Unresolved问题。如何转换为google表格格式?当我创建要使用PyDrive上传的文件时,我试图将mimeType指定为'application/vnd.google-apps.spreadsheet',但这给了我一个错误。如何将文件设置为任何知道链接的人都可以编辑?设置完成后,我可以使用PyDrive轻松获得共
我的Google云端硬盘集成网络应用程序在drive范围内运行良好,但除非必要,否则使用如此广泛的范围是不好的做法。我想将范围限制为drive.file,这样我只能访问应用程序创建的文件和使用GooglePicker打开的文件,但我无法让它工作。应用程序创建的文件可以毫无问题地打开。但是,无法访问使用GooglePicker打开的文件;尝试下载此类文件会导致404错误。当我右键单击Google云端硬盘中的文件并选择“查看授权应用”时,我的应用程序未列为授权应用之一。如果范围扩展到drive,代码工作正常。我写了一个minimaltestpage,它应该下载用户在GooglePicker
我的Google云端硬盘集成网络应用程序在drive范围内运行良好,但除非必要,否则使用如此广泛的范围是不好的做法。我想将范围限制为drive.file,这样我只能访问应用程序创建的文件和使用GooglePicker打开的文件,但我无法让它工作。应用程序创建的文件可以毫无问题地打开。但是,无法访问使用GooglePicker打开的文件;尝试下载此类文件会导致404错误。当我右键单击Google云端硬盘中的文件并选择“查看授权应用”时,我的应用程序未列为授权应用之一。如果范围扩展到drive,代码工作正常。我写了一个minimaltestpage,它应该下载用户在GooglePicker